For those looking to purchase tickets, it's important to note that Upton (Merseyside) station doesn't have a ticket office or ticket machines. You will need to purchase your tickets online or at an alternative station if you prefer collecting them in-person. The station is equipped with an induction loop to assist individuals with hearing impairments, which can be valuable for receiving station announcements.
Step-free access is available, but with limitations. Platform 1 has a ramp with steps that are not suitable for wheelchairs, while Platform 2 can be accessed via a steep gradient with handrails. For those needing assistance, the Passenger Assist service is available if booked in advance. While there are no staffed help points or seating in waiting rooms, there is a seating area available.
Other facilities such as toilets, refreshment options, and bike storage are not available, so it's best to plan accordingly. If you rely on Wi-Fi or need to use a payphone, you'll have to look for those services elsewhere, as they are not provided. For lost property inquiries, you can contact Transport for Wales.
When it comes to onward travel, Upton is seamlessly connected to various modes of transport. The bus stops can be conveniently found across the road from the station and to the left, making it easy to catch a local bus to your next destination. If the trains aren’t running, a rail replacement service operates from a local bus stop nearby. Small Heath Station offers essential services to facilitate your journey. The ticket office operates on weekdays from 07:00 to 10:00, ensuring you can grab a last-minute ticket or seek help if needed.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available, and you can collect tickets purchased online here too. It's worth noting that while the station is fitted with an induction loop for those with hearing impairments, it lacks step-free access—a crucial point for travelers with mobility needs.
Even though Small Heath Station doesn't have a waiting room, there are seating areas to ensure comfort while you wait. Additionally, CCTV coverage throughout the station helps in ensuring passenger security. While there are no refreshment facilities or shops here, the vibrancy of Birmingham ensures you'll find plenty of those in the vicinity.
Small Heath's connectivity spans beyond trains, with various travel options available. Rail replacement services, when required, operate from the front of the station, making it easy for passengers to switch travel modes without a hitch. Taxis are readily available with local services like Heartlands and Silverline offering convenient pick-up and drop-off options. For the eco-conscious or budget traveler, local bus services provide an excellent way to navigate Birmingham's sights and sounds.
